
“A TRADITIONAL hand-woven Christmas tree was lit at the Cultural Center of the Philippine’s (CCP) Liwasang Asean Park last Nov. 3.
Rochelle Ong, an architecture alumna of UST, together with her partner in WTA Architecture & Design Studio, Louie Suico, mounted their winning design proposal “Habi ng Pagkakaisa: Weaving the Multi-Cultural Filipino Together.”
This year’s holiday light installation of CCP and OMNI (Yatai International Corp.) emphasized Filipino lantern-making technology and eco-friendliness in line with the theme “Paskong Pinoy.””… Learn more.
